Open to work

Desarrollador de Software Junior. Convierto ideas en aplicaciones web completas: interfaces cuidadas, backend sólido y código pensado para que dure. Cada proyecto es una excusa para aprender algo nuevo.

Rock 'n code 🤘

sergio@dev:~
~$ whoamiconst dev = { name: "Sergio Zarcero", role: "Software Dev", location: "Madrid, ES", status: "open_to_work",};
01.

sobre mí

Soy Sergio, desarrollador de software junior. Vengo del CFGS de Desarrollo de Aplicaciones Web en el CIFP Virgen de Gracia habiendo realizado prácticas en Minsait.

Me gusta el código bien organizado: arquitectura limpia, principios SOLID y proyectos que sean mantenibles y escalables. He trabajado tanto en backend (Java, NestJS, Laravel) como en frontend (React, Angular), siempre con entornos dockerizados y control de versiones desde el primer commit.

Esto es una carrera de fondo y no me gusta quedarme atrás, por lo que también experimento con las novedades del mundo tech, como los flujos de desarrollo asistidos por agentes de IA (Claude Code, MCP, SDD): me interesa cómo integrarlos en el día a día sin perder criterio propio. Y cuando no estoy programando, probablemente esté escuchando rock.

ubicación
Madrid, España
rol objetivo
Desarrollador de Software / Backend / IA
formación
CFGS DAW
estado
Open to work
02.

stack técnico

Backend

Java Spring Boot NestJS Laravel PHP Node.js Kotlin WebSockets

Frontend

TypeScript JavaScript React Angular Astro Tailwind CSS HTML / CSS

Bases de datos y ORM

PostgreSQL MySQL / MariaDB MongoDB Redis Prisma Eloquent

Herramientas y DevOps

Docker Git / GitHub Nginx Vite

IA aplicada al desarrollo

SDD Claude Code MCP Flujos agénticos
03.

proyectos

Proclade

Plataforma web para una fundación sin ánimo de lucro

Plataforma web completa desarrollada en equipo para la fundación Proclade: autenticación con roles, panel de administración y chatbot con base de conocimiento propia. Monorepo con entorno completamente dockerizado y Nginx como proxy inverso.

  • Autenticación y autorización con roles (admin / usuario)
  • Panel de administración para gestionar el contenido de la plataforma
  • Chatbot con base de conocimiento cargada en la inicialización
  • Entorno de desarrollo 100% dockerizado: API, frontend y proxy
  • Casi 300 commits de trabajo en equipo con documentación técnica
React NestJS Prisma PostgreSQL TypeScript Docker Nginx

Lupis Insani

Juego multijugador en tiempo real en el navegador

Adaptación web de Los Hombres Lobo de Castronegro: partidas multijugador en tiempo real con WebSockets, lógica de juego procesada de forma asíncrona con colas y workers, y un entorno dockerizado con seis servicios orquestados.

  • Comunicación en tiempo real con Laravel Reverb (WebSockets)
  • Lógica de partida asíncrona con colas y workers de Laravel
  • Redis para caché y gestión de colas
  • Arquitectura de seis servicios orquestados con Docker Compose
Laravel 12 TypeScript MariaDB Redis WebSockets Docker Nginx

otros proyectos

Batalla Friki

API REST de batallas entre personajes

API construida con NestJS y TypeScript para simular batallas entre personajes de distintos universos, con arquitectura modular de controladores, servicios y DTOs.

NestJS TypeScript Node.js

Anillos del Poder

Single Page Application con Angular

Aplicación Angular sobre el universo de El Señor de los Anillos: componentes tipados, servicios inyectables y enrutado de la SPA.

Angular TypeScript

Django Ultimate Team

Gestor de plantillas al estilo Ultimate Team

Aplicación web con Django para crear y gestionar equipos de fútbol al estilo Ultimate Team: modelos relacionales, vistas y plantillas del framework.

Django Python

Ver todos los repositorios en GitHub →

04.

trayectoria

  1. 2026 · Periodo de prácticas

    Desarrollador Java en prácticas

    Minsait

    Prácticas de desarrollo backend con Java en un entorno corporativo: trabajo con equipos reales, control de versiones y metodologías de la empresa.

    Java Backend Git
  2. 2024 — 2026

    CFGS Desarrollo de Aplicaciones Web (DAW)

    Formación Profesional de Grado Superior

    Formación en desarrollo de software web: Java, PHP, JavaScript y TypeScript, bases de datos relacionales, desarrollo de APIs y despliegue de aplicaciones web.

    Desarrollo web Java PHP TypeScript SQL

05. contacto

¿Hablamos?

Estoy buscando mi primera oportunidad como desarrollador junior. Si crees que encajo en tu equipo, escríbeme y te respondo rápido.

zar0_31@outlook.com